Cassia mimosoides L.

 
  • Family : FABACEAE
  • Family (As per The Plant List) : Fabaceae (Leguminosae)
  • Subfamily : Caesalpinioideae
  • Species : Cassia mimosoides
  • Species Name (as per The Plant List) : Chamaecrista mimosoides (L.) Greene
  • Common name : Feather-leaved Cassia, Mimosa like-Senna
  • Collection Nos : KFP 2728, KFP 2930
  • Collector(s) Name : K.R.Keshava Murthy & K.P.Sreenath
  • Key identification features : A delicate herb with compound leaves. Leaflets are small in several pairs. Flower are upto 0.5-0.8 cm across and solitary in leaf axils. Fruit is a flat, many-seeded pod.
  • Habit : Herb
  • Native : Old World Tropics
  • Comments : Grows on the floor of scrub and also in the open.
  • Conservation Status : Not Evaluated (NE)
  • Collection Locality : Sagar (Shimoga)
  • Distribution Locality : Bagalkot, Bangalore, Belgaum, Bellary, Bidar, Bijapur, Chamrajnagar, Chikamagalur, Chikkaballapur, Chitradurga, Dakshina Kannada, Davanagere, Dharwad, Gadag, Gulbarga, Hassan, Haveri, Kodagu, Kolar, Koppal, Mandya, Mysore, Raichur, Ramanagara, Shimoga, Tumkur, Udupi, Uttara Kannada, Yadgir
  • Floras referred : Saldanha & Nicolson, 1976 - Hassan; Gowda, 2004 - Sringeri; Ramaswamy & Razi, 1973 - Bangalore; Seetharam et al., 2000 - Gulbarga; Rao & Razi, 1981 - Mysore; Keshava Murthy & Yoganarasimhan, 1990 - Coorg; Gopalakrishna Bhat, 2003 - Udupi; Manjunath et al., 2003 - Davanagere; Gopalakrishna Bhat, 2014 - Flora of South Kanara
